About Abhishek Narayan Verma
Man is made up of history. I feel that unless and until I delve into my own history, I would not be able to be at creation’s front, even though I am creating a physical record of my experiences so far.
When I look at my works I feel that I am telling a story. At the same time, I feel that I am listening to a story. Art for me, in this sense, is a bridge that connects not only two spaces but two times. It is my visual history narrated through forms and colours while dabbling in arrangement at a more subconscious level.
My paintings and drawings are the conscious effort to connect with my village through all my experiences and memories. The explorative process is from the individual to the universal. I wish to exhibit a phase of the constant within the ever-changing, giving impulse a path to deliberation. What appears before me, then, is a synthesis of my senses with psychology and intellect.
